Understanding Safety Advice at Music Festivals
Preparation for potential emergencies at global music events involves understanding specific global music event safety requirements. Festival security measures usually include bag checks, visible security personnel, and secured perimeters to maintain a controlled environment for attendees. Event organizer safety measures also address potential safety concerns through announcements and visible signage at venues. Comprehensive crowd control procedures coupled with proper safety protocols play essential roles in minimizing risks during large gatherings and ensuring rapid audience emergency response plans.

Learn Health Precautions for Overseas Festivals
Travelers attending international festivals should take steps like vaccinations and packing a travel health kit to protect themselves from common health risks. In my experience at events like the Rio Carnival, I ensured access to medical assistance abroad by knowing the location of nearby hospitals and having local health services contacts on hand. The World Health Organization has highlighted that overseas festival health risks include foodborne illnesses, so staying hydrated and eating safely is vital. Preparing for different climates is crucial, as I learned by wearing layers for the Glastonbury Festival, which can often be rainy, ensuring adaptability to weather changes.
